Output 89e15d23c60ab634a4ebd9c7afe21c71a546dd8fdff4eca799bcf186dd6477ed:0

value
1864496
script pubkey
OP_0 OP_PUSHBYTES_20 bf557d74a5d49ac055144aba4eedcd4fb92a7169
address
bc1qha2h6a996jdvq4g5f2ayamwdf7uj5utfa5ltud
transaction
89e15d23c60ab634a4ebd9c7afe21c71a546dd8fdff4eca799bcf186dd6477ed
confirmations
78297
spent
true